PGA Tour: Tiger Woods, Nicklaus, Snead Move Over for Scottie Scheffler


Scottie Scheffler is currently more than just the favorite in virtually every tournament he plays—his every start is potentially a historic milestone. As you may guess, Scheffler’s victory in the 2025 Memorial Tournament was no exception.

His win at Muirfield Village made him the fourth-quickest player in PGA Tour history between their first and 16th win on Tour. Who did it faster? Some guys named Sam Snead, Jack Nicklaus, and Tiger Woods.

His victory also made him only the second player to win the Memorial Tournament in consecutive years. Woods was the previous to do so, having won in 1999, 2000, and 2001 (he would later win again in 2009 and 2012).

The World No. 1 also joined a select group of players who have won seven tournaments by four or more strokes over the past 40 years. According to golf statistician Justin Ray, Scheffler is joined by Phil Mickelson, Rory McIlroy, and Vijay Singh, and they all follow Dustin Johnson (8), Davis Love III (9), and Tiger Woods (24).

Only Woods and Scheffler among this group have achieved three or more wins by four or more strokes in a single season. Woods won five such events in 2000 and three in 2003, while Scheffler won three in 2024 and has the same amount already in 2025.

However, Scheffler claims he pays little attention to these and the other reasons why the golf world considers him the best player today.

“I don’t really think about that stuff, to be honest with you,” Scheffler said after his victory. “I treat each tournament individually, and every tournament’s different, and I try to do my best to come out here and compete.”

“That’s what I love to do. I love being able to play the PGA Tour, and I love being able to compete against the best players in the world and play on great golf courses like this one and be able to play in these legacy tournaments, like Mr. Palmer’s tournament, Mr. Nicklaus’s tournament.”

Scheffler won the Memorial Tournament with a score of 10-under, finishing four strokes ahead of Ben Griffin. He carded rounds of 70, 70, 68, and 70 and reached 31 consecutive bogey-free holes between the second and fourth rounds.

The Ridgewood, New Jersey native has now won three tournaments this season, including a major championship. He has finished in the top 25 in all 12 PGA Tour events he has played in this year.
